1\. Fully Automated Mode Activation

When working with Claude Code, permission requests for risky operations \(like deleting files or running scripts\) can interrupt tasks\. Use this command to grant full permissions:


claude --dangerously-skip-permissions

Use Case: Ideal when you fully trust Claude’s execution capabilities and want to avoid frequent interruptions, such as when automating batch file processing or running complex scripts\.

2\. Project Initialization

For new projects, this command scans your codebase and generates a CLAUDE\.md file, which documents core commands, architectural standards, and workflow guidelines\.


/init

Use Case: When onboarding an existing project, run this command to quickly understand the project’s structure and constraints\. Claude will reference CLAUDE\.md in every conversation, ensuring consistency\.

3\. @ Symbol for Context Injection

Easily add files or directories to the conversation context:


@file/path
@directory/path

Use Case: When debugging code, reference a specific script with @scripts/debug\.py to let Claude analyze it\. For a full module, use @modules/auth to include all related files\.

4\. Restore Historical Sessions

Never lose progress with these commands to resume conversations:


claude --continue  # Resume the last session
claude --resume    # Select from a list of sessions
/resume            # Switch sessions in an active chat

Use Case: If you pause a task midway, use claude \-\-continue to pick up right where you left off, whether it’s coding, data analysis, or content creation\.

5\. Context Management

Keep your conversation context organized with these commands:


/clear    # Reset context
/compact  # Compress long conversations
/context  # Check current context usage

Best Practice: Maintain context at around 50% capacity for optimal performance, especially during lengthy coding or research sessions\.

6\. Self\-Insight Report

Generate a detailed HTML report analyzing your usage over the past month:


/insights

What You Get:

  • Data Dashboard: Session count, token usage, and Git commit stats\.
  • Friction Analysis: Identifies time\-wasting patterns \(e\.g\., repeated prompts\)\.
  • Actionable Tips: Code snippets to optimize your workflow\.

7\. Update to the Latest Version

Regularly update to access new features and bug fixes:


claude --update

Use Case: Run this weekly to ensure you’re using the most stable and feature\-rich version\.

8\. Auto\-Permission Mode

A safer alternative to full automation, this mode uses an AI model to assess operation safety:


claude --permission-mode auto

Difference from Command 1: While \-\-dangerously\-skip\-permissions skips all checks, this mode adds a safety layer, making it ideal for less trusted workflows\.

9\. Advanced Built\-in Skills

Tackle complex tasks with these specialized commands:

  • Code Optimization:

```bash

/simplify

```

Automatically identifies reusable or redundant code sections and fixes them\.

  • Batch Processing:

```bash

/batch

```

Splits tasks into parallel units, each isolated with Git worktrees\.

  • Debugging Claude:

```bash

/debug

```

Analyzes session logs to diagnose unexpected behavior\.

10\. Skill Plugin Installation

Extend Claude’s capabilities with plugins, categorized by scope:

  • Project\-Level: Only active in the current project\.
  • Global\-Level: Active across all projects on your machine\.

# Install a project-level skill
claude skill install <skill-name> --project
# Install a global-level skill
claude skill install <skill-name> --global

Best Practice: Limit project\-level skills to 20 per project to avoid performance issues\.
